You are about to suction a 10-year-old patient who has a 6-mm (internal diameter) endotracheal tube in place. What is the maximum size of catheter that you would use in this case? a. 6 Fr b. 8 Fr c. 10 Fr d. 14 Fr

ANS: C To estimate quickly the proper size of suction catheter to use with a given tracheal tube, first multiply the tube's inner diameter by 2. Then use the next smallest size catheter.

What is the primary indication for tracheal suctioning? a. Presence of pneumonia b. Presence of atelectasis c. Ineffective coughing d. Retention of secretions

ANS: D Airway obstruction can be caused by retained secretions, foreign bodies, and structural changes such as edema, tumors, or trauma. Retained secretions increase airway resistance and the work of breathing and can cause hypoxemia, hypercapnia, atelectasis, and infection. Difficulty in clearing secretions may be due to the thickness or amount of the secretions or to the patient's inability to generate an effective cough. RTs can remove retained secretions or other semi-liquid fluids from the airways by suctioning.

Which of the following methods can help to reduce the likelihood of atelectasis due to tracheal suctioning? 1. Limit the amount of negative pressure used. 2. Hyperinflate the patient before and after the procedure. 3. Suction for as short a period of time as possible. a. 1 and 2 only b. 1 and 3 only c. 2 and 3 only d. 1, 2, and 3

ANS: D Atelectasis can be caused by removal of too much air from the lungs. You can avoid this complication by (1) limiting the amount of negative pressure used, (2) keeping the duration of suctioning as short as possible, and (3) providing hyperinflation before and after the procedure.

To minimize the problems associated with pharyngeal aspiration in intubated patients, which of the following could you recommend? 1. Position patients in prone position. 2. Use of medications for stress ulcer prophylaxis, such as sucralfate. 3. Positioning of patients with the head of the bed elevated 30 degrees. 4. Provide continuous aspiration of subglottic secretions. a. 1 and 2 only b. 2 and 4 only c. 1, 2, and 4 only d. 2, 3, and 4 only

ANS: D Techniques to decrease the consequences of pharyngeal aspiration include: (1) use of medications for stress ulcer prophylaxis, such as sucralfate, that maintain normal gastric pH; (2) positioning of patients with the head of the bed elevated 30 degrees or more to decrease reflux; and (3) continuous aspiration of subglottic secretions.
